Description:
1) Power source: Rechargeable Battery 6V/4Ah or AC adaptor(9V,
500mA)
2) How Battery is charged completely?
The charging voltage is regulated by Q1 (C1061) and ZD1 (8.2V) for
about 7 volts.
The
charging
current
will
go
down
automatically
when
voltage
reached.
Q2 (C945) and R1 (1.2R, 1/2W) provide Over-Current protection.
3) +5V power drives digital circuit system.
U6 (AIC 1722-5.0) is a 5volts Voltage Regulator.
4) +5V power drives analog circuit system.
U4 (NS2950A) is a 5volts Voltage Regulator.
4) Auto-off:
If the scale is set with 4_oFF or even under LO-BAT situation,
after fixed time interval, CPU will release a low potential signal
to draw down Q2, then Q1 cuts off, the scale will be shut down
immediately.
5) Low Power Detection:
The Q6(A733) is designed to detect the power level. When battery
power
is
less
than
5.5V,
the
collector
pole
will
become
high
potential,
then CPU will instruct LCD display to show LO-BAT symbol.
4.2.1.2 Input voltage: 5.5V or higher
Check and recharge battery if voltage is less than 5.5V.
4.2.1.3 System voltage (Vcc): 5V +/- 10%
Check that the system voltage is within 5V +/- 10%
a) less than 4.5V, the CPU may not work properly.
b) more than 6V, ghost will appear on LCD.
4.2.2 Platform Stopper Checking
The platform device shall not touch anything around itself during
operation. Check that the platform is not contacted with the upper
(no load) and/or lower (with load) stopper.
4.2.3 LCD Display Checking
4.2.3.1
Check that it is soldered and connected properly between LCD
and driver IC (PCF8576), driver IC (PCF8576) and CPU.
